In a world facing economic turbulence and supply chain disruptions, the China International Supply Chain Expo (CISCE) has emerged as a beacon of hope for global trade.
The third CISCE recently took place, attracting over 650 enterprises and institutions from 75 countries, regions, and international organizations. With six major supply chain sectors and a dedicated service exhibition area, the expo showcased the latest achievements and experiences in global industrial and supply chain cooperation.
Amid rising challenges to economic globalization, the CISCE plays a crucial role in promoting international collaboration. The expo’s increasing proportion of overseas exhibitors, now at 35 percent, underscores its commitment to fostering partnerships between Chinese and foreign enterprises.
